回 帖 发 新 帖 刷新版面

主题:难题(2)

题目:
    不等式的解
    给出一些不等式,求其公共解集.
    注意:表达方式:x<3表示为(-,3)(“-”号表示无穷小,且不要表示为 (3,-),其左边只能用'(',下同)x<=3表示为(-,3].x>3表示为(3,+),x>=3表示为[3,+)("+"表示无穷大,其右边只能用")')1<=x<=3表示为[1,3].对于每一组数据,肯定有解.
    "或"的表示:1<=x<3或x>5表示为:[1,3) (5,+)
    输入数据第一行为n,表示有n个不等式(组)
    以下n行为不等式(组)
    输出数据为公共解集,重复的只输出一个,且最后的解集后面不要有多余空格,每个解集之间只要有一个空格.
    样例:
    Input:
    3
    [1,10) [3,11] (5,+)
    (-10,11]
    (0,7) (-1,8]
    Output:
    [1,7) [1,8] [3,7) [3,8] (5,7) (5,8]

回复列表 (共21个回复)

沙发

咋没人回答???

板凳

做N次傻傻的循环就能解决问题
聪明点的方法想不出

3 楼

!!!!![em10]

4 楼

引用:
    做N次傻傻的循环就能解决问题
    聪明点的方法想不出

什么意思??

5 楼

快快帮帮忙!!~~

6 楼

等会儿,下午给你程序……[em19][em19]

让我编一会儿~~

不对呀,输出的不就是一个公共解级吗,怎么那么一大串??
题目懂了,但你的样例有问题没??[em18][em18][em18]

7 楼

仔细看题!!!
真怀疑你是否看题了
如果你看了题就不会问那么不理智的问题了

8 楼


谁说我没看?
可是我的理解是:
   每一行是独立的一个不等式组,其中每个不等式之间是“或“的关系;
   要求的是这几个不等式组的公共解集,不是吗?[em18][em18][em18]

9 楼

不是的
例:(样例数据)
[1,10) [3,11] (5,+)
(-10,11]
(0,7) (-1,8]
是求{[1,10)、(-10,11]、(0,7)}、{[1,10)、(-10,11]、(-1,8]}、、、、的解集,再把它们通通打出来.
如果是按你说的,我干吗非要分那么多行写?!直接一行不更好?

10 楼

无语ing ~~~~~

我估计没有人能理解你的问题!!
这是程序。(一次放不下,分两次)
哈哈哈哈哈!!不要低估我的能力哦!![em9][em9]

我来回复

您尚未登录,请登录后再回复。点此登录或注册